If you're concerned about the tread on your tires, we recommend the “penny test” to check your tread depth. Simply insert a penny into your tire's tread groove with Lincoln's head upside down and facing you. If you can see all of Lincoln's head, your tread depth is less than 2/32 inch and it's time to replace your tires.
Why Proper Wheel Alignment Matters for Your Vehicle's Health
Many drivers think a wheel alignment is only about stopping the car from "pulling" to one side or preventing uneven tire wear. While it's excellent for saving money on tires, the true importance of proper alignment goes much deeper—it's about protecting the long-term health and safety of your vehicle's most critical components.
When your wheels are out of alignment, they are essentially "fighting" each other and the road. This creates constant, unnecessary stress on your entire steering and suspension system. This strain can cause expensive parts like ball joints, tie rods, and wheel bearings to wear out prematurely. A simple, inexpensive alignment check can often prevent a much more costly and complex auto repair down the road.
Furthermore, proper alignment is a critical safety feature. A misaligned vehicle may not respond predictably in an emergency. This is especially true for Chanhassen drivers, as precise steering control is essential for safely navigating slick, icy roads or swerving to avoid a pothole. An alignment ensures your car handles exactly as it was designed to, giving you a stable, predictable, and safer ride.

What Are the Signs of Tire Misalignment?
Tire misalignment often causes symptoms like uneven tire wear, a vehicle pulling to one side, or a vibrating steering wheel. Regular inspections at Christian Brothers Automotive Chanhassen help detect issues early and keep your vehicle performing safely.
If you notice more difficult steering or less precise handling, those may also signal misalignment. A sudden rise in fuel consumption could point to alignment issues as well. Ignoring these warning signs often leads to more serious problems, so timely maintenance makes a difference.

Can Tire Alignment Affect Gas Mileage?
Yes, tire alignment affects fuel efficiency. Misaligned tires increase resistance, forcing your car to use more fuel to move forward. Q. "What is the difference between a wheel alignment and a wheel balance?"Wheel alignment is the term for how your wheels sit when mounted to your car and wheel balancing is what’s done to perfectly balance the weight of a tire and wheel assembly so that it travels evenly.

Q. "What causes bad alignment?"Normal wear and tear can eventually cause your car to come out of alignment, but perhaps a more sudden occurrence would be things like hitting potholes, bumping curbs, or even minor accidents. Click here to read more on the causes and consequences of bad alignment.
